Tour Leader, United States
Do you dream of inspiring travellers and helping them fall in love with their destination by immersing them in your local culture and exposing them to real life experiences? Being a Tour Leader with Intrepid, you will do just that!
Every day will be different, but every day you will:
-
Provide amazing customer service and travel advice – whether it's guiding a city walking tour, organizing a step-on Native American guided experience or arranging a meal in a new city, you’ll create unforgettable moments that our travellers will never forget.
-
Ensure the safety and well-being of your travellers, at times you will have to assist in difficult situations while remaining calm and professional. A traveller may lose their passport, need medical attention, or there may be a clash of personalities and you will be the first point of call.
-
Host, lead and execute tours to budget, following the itinerary and fulfil your administrative duties.
-
Be passionate about travel and share your love of it with our customers. Every step of the way you’ll embody our core values of Integrity, Passion, Fun, Innovation and Responsibility.

What you need to know:
-
This is a seasonal position with the expectation that you are available to work for the entirety of peak season (August - October).
-
You will need a few valid certificates prior to starting with us including a First Aid, CPR, Leave No Trace, Food Handler’s and a US Driver’s License.
-
We are recruiting for leaders in May and June with training prior to start.
-
With extended hours, lots of walking and activities, and engaging with travellers, so, it’s important that you are prepared both mentally and physically for the challenge!
-
You’ll need the ability to travel and spend time away from home, as our leaders often travel for extensive periods at a time.
